We are a specialist NHS Foundation Trust providing community, mental health, and learning disability services for the people of Barnsley, Calderdale, Kirklees, and Wakefield. We also provide low and medium secure services and are the lead for the West Yorkshire secure provider collaborative.
Our mission is to help people reach their potential and live well in their communities by providing high-quality care in the right place at the right time. We employ staff in both clinical and non-clinical roles who work hard to make a difference in the lives of service users, families, and carers.
We encourage and welcome applications from all protected characteristic groups. We value diversity and aim for our workforce to reflect our communities.
Being a foundation Trust means we are accountable to our members, who can have a say in how we are run. Around 14,300 local people, including staff, are members of our Trust.

Visa sponsorship under the Health and Care Worker visa route can only be considered if the prorated salary meets the minimum threshold of £25,000, as required by UK Visas and Immigration. For Band 3 roles, only full-time positions at the top of the pay scale meet this threshold. Sponsorship may not be possible depending on salary placement and working hours.
